For transparency sake i will post some of the subjective downsides of the ESC: The main point being that most of the full time supercharger kits will make more peak power. Im not very familiar with HKS but the Kraftwerks, Jackson and Vortech kit all make more power above 5500rpm. The base Innovate kit is almost a toss up for performance....especially if you consider the free e85 tune you get when you buy the OFT from Shiv. That being said that ESC makes more torque than ALL the above kits from 2000rpm to about 5000RPM(+/-500rpm) which is a nice bonus especially considering the other great positive points (Price and install complexity). Rob is always working to develop the platform, since launch we already have two add ons( Aux charger for double recharge rate, 1.5 dump pack conversion for ~10whp more) ....
